上海阿里云代理商:ArcGIS JS 鼠标滚轮交互优化的服务器安全防护方案
一、ArcGIS JS 鼠标滚轮交互的服务器支撑需求
ArcGIS JS作为WebGIS开发的核心工具链,其地图缩放(鼠标滚轮)等交互功能对服务器响应有严格要求。上海地区企业在使用阿里云服务部署GIS系统时,需重点关注:
- 高并发地图瓦片请求处理能力
- 动态矢量数据服务的低延迟响应
- WebSocket长连接的稳定性保障
阿里云ecs选择建议:8核16G以上配置搭配ESSD云盘,配合负载均衡SLB实现请求分流。实测数据显示,此配置可支持200+并发用户流畅操作鼠标滚轮缩放。
二、DDoS防火墙对GIS服务的特殊防护策略
针对ArcGIS服务常见的攻击特征,上海阿里云代理商建议启用以下防护机制:
| 攻击类型 | 防护方案 | 配置参数 |
|---|---|---|
| 瓦片请求洪水攻击 | 频率控制+人机验证 | 单IP 50请求/秒阈值 |
| WebSocket连接耗尽 | 连接数限制 | 最大600连接/实例 |
典型案例:某城市规划局系统遭遇针对zoom级别参数的CC攻击,通过阿里云DDoS pro的智能学习模型,准确识别异常缩放行为特征,误杀率低于0.3%。

三、waf防火墙对ArcGIS API的深度防护
ArcGIS JS API特有的安全风险需要定制WAF规则:
- 参数过滤:对extent、zoom等参数进行SQL注入检测
- 内容校验:识别异常GeoJSON格式数据请求
- 行为分析:建立鼠标滚轮操作基线(如正常用户每分钟缩放操作6-15次)
配置示例:开启阿里云WAF的地理围栏功能,限制非上海区域的异常访问。同时设置爬虫防护规则,阻止自动化数据采集工具。
四、高可用架构设计解决方案
上海阿里云代理商推荐的多层防护架构:
客户端(ArcGIS JS) → cdn(缓存静态瓦片) → DDoS防护 → WAF防火墙 → 应用服务器集群 → 分布式空间数据库 ↑ 日志审计系统
关键优化点:
- 使用阿里云P2P网络加速瓦片传输
- 配置Auto Scaling应对突发流量
- 通过日志服务分析异常滚轮操作模式
五、性能与安全的平衡实践
实测数据对比(上海外高桥机房):
| 防护等级 | 平均响应时间 | 攻击拦截率 |
|---|---|---|
| 基础防护 | 128ms | 78% |
| 增强防护 | 157ms | 99.6% |
| 智能模式 | 142ms | 95.2% |
推荐采用智能模式,在业务高峰时段自动调整防护策略,确保鼠标滚轮操作的流畅性。
六、总结与核心价值
本文以上海地区企业使用ArcGIS JS的鼠标滚轮交互为切入点,深入探讨了阿里云服务器安全防护体系的关键要点。通过DDoS防火墙应对流量型攻击、WAF防护应用层威胁、以及高可用架构设计,实现三大核心价值:保障GIS服务的持续可用性、确保空间数据安全性、优化终端用户交互体验。上海阿里云代理商建议采用分层防御策略,在网络安全与系统性能之间取得最佳平衡,为WebGIS应用构建坚实可靠的云上基石。

kf@jusoucn.com
4008-020-360


4008-020-360
